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16 07 40881865196 23825248
556589385 6538066763 20471
556589385 6538066763 20471
15102759 166 29166117 159
All about undefined
Interested in learning more?
556589385 6538066763 20471
15102759 166 29166117 159
See more
6898264590 83316 69384362
9239459 141481550 85430
See more
300073 1468
47393 787 923 6886
See more